European defence spending: Poland spends larger share of GDP than US
Why this matters: an international story with cross-border implications worth tracking.
Defence spending across European NATO is at its highest since the Cold War, with countries closest to Russia spending the most. But the continent is splitting between front-line states racing towards 5% of GDP and a large group doing the bare minimum.
